The specific heat at constant pressure and at constant volume for an ideal gas are Cp and Cv and adiabetic & isothermal elasticities are Eɸ and Eθ respectively. What is the ratio of Eɸ and Eθ.

(A) (Cv / Cp)

(B) (Cp / Cv)

(C) Cp Cv

(D) [1 / CpCv]

1 Answer

+4 votes
by kratos
 
Best answer

Correct option: (B) (Cp / Cv)

Explanation:

[(Adiabetic elasticity) / (isothermal elasticity)] = (Eɸ / Eθ)

(Eɸ / Eθ) = (Ѵp / P) = Ѵ and Ѵ = (Cp / CV)

Hence (Eɸ / Eθ) = (Cp / CV)
